100 Bible Verses about Enduring Persecution

2 Timothy 3:12 ESV / 10 helpful votes

Indeed, all who desire to live a godly life in Christ Jesus will be persecuted,

1 Corinthians 10:13 ESV / 8 helpful votes

No temptation has overtaken you that is not common to man. God is faithful, and he will not let you be tempted beyond your ability, but with the temptation he will also provide the way of escape, that you may be able to endure it.

Romans 8:28 ESV / 8 helpful votes

And we know that for those who love God all things work together for good, for those who are called according to his purpose.

Romans 12:14 ESV / 6 helpful votes

Bless those who persecute you; bless and do not curse them.

Matthew 5:10-12 ESV / 6 helpful votes

“Blessed are those who are persecuted for righteousness' sake, for theirs is the kingdom of heaven. “Blessed are you when others revile you and persecute you and utter all kinds of evil against you falsely on my account. Rejoice and be glad, for your reward is great in heaven, for so they persecuted the prophets who were before you.

Matthew 5:10 ESV / 6 helpful votes

“Blessed are those who are persecuted for righteousness' sake, for theirs is the kingdom of heaven.

1 Peter 4:16 ESV / 5 helpful votes

Yet if anyone suffers as a Christian, let him not be ashamed, but let him glorify God in that name.

1 Peter 3:14 ESV / 5 helpful votes

But even if you should suffer for righteousness' sake, you will be blessed. Have no fear of them, nor be troubled,

1 Peter 2:20 ESV / 5 helpful votes

For what credit is it if, when you sin and are beaten for it, you endure? But if when you do good and suffer for it you endure, this is a gracious thing in the sight of God.

2 Corinthians 12:10 ESV / 5 helpful votes

For the sake of Christ, then, I am content with weaknesses, insults, hardships, persecutions, and calamities. For when I am weak, then I am strong.

Romans 12:12 ESV / 5 helpful votes

Rejoice in hope, be patient in tribulation, be constant in prayer.

John 16:33 ESV / 5 helpful votes

I have said these things to you, that in me you may have peace. In the world you will have tribulation. But take heart; I have overcome the world.”

Isaiah 41:10 ESV / 5 helpful votes

Fear not, for I am with you; be not dismayed, for I am your God; I will strengthen you, I will help you, I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.
